Is Algeria warmer or hotter than Cleveland, Ohio?

On average across the year, yes, Algeria is hotter than Cleveland, Ohio . Algeria has an average temperature of 19°C/66°F and Cleveland, Ohio has an average temperature of 9°C/48°F.

Algeria's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 36°C/97°F, which is hotter than Cleveland, Ohio's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 28°C/82°F).

Is Algeria colder or cooler than Cleveland, Ohio?

On average across the year, no, Algeria is not colder than Cleveland, Ohio . Algeria has an average minimum temperature of 13°C/55°F and Cleveland, Ohio has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F.



Algeria's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 5°C/41°F, which is not colder than Cleveland, Ohio's coldest month (February, with an average minimum temperature of -9°C/16°F).

Does Algeria have more rain than Cleveland, Ohio?

On average across the year, no, Algeria has less rain than Cleveland, Ohio. Algeria has an average annual rainfall of 203mm and Cleveland, Ohio has an average annual rainfall of 1507mm.

Algeria's wettest month is February, with an average monthly rainfall of 35mm, which is drier than Cleveland, Ohio's wettest month (October, with an average monthly rainfall of 162mm).
